Most leading digital assets have posted minor losses over the past 24 hours, while the total capitalization of the crypto market has slightly retreated during the same period. The popular privacy token Monero (XMR) defied the ongoing conditions, registering a double-digit increase and nearing the prestigious top 10 club. Here’s what fueled the rally. Leading the Gainers XMR is the best-performing cryptocurrency from the top 100 list today (August 31), with its price briefly surging to almost $530, the highest since January this year. Currently, it trades at around $525 (per CoinGecko), representing a 43% jump on a monthly scale. The asset’s market cap jumped to nearly $10 billion, overtaking well-known altcoins like Chainlink (LINK) and Cardano (ADA) and making it the 13th-largest cryptocurrency. Perhaps the biggest catalyst for the move north is THORChain’s network upgrade, which reportedly introduced native support for XMR swaps.
